Biography
Dr. Emma Sam serves as Executive Board Advisor at Cuneiform, where she leads the medical devices R&D efforts within our embedded development division. With an MSc in Biomedical Engineering from Brunel University and extensive clinical experience as a dentist, she brings a unique blend of medical expertise and engineering innovation to our team.
Her research focuses on technical innovation in medical instruments, tools and implants, with particular expertise in CAE/FEA methodology for developing next-generation medical devices. Dr. Sam's work on narrow-diameter dental implants and her investigation of stability and integration techniques has contributed significantly to advancing medical device technology.
As a multilingual professional fluent in Arabic, Farsi and English, Dr. Sam effectively bridges technical innovation with practical medical applications.
